WebAug 10, 2015 · Discoid lupus erythematosus is a chronic scarring skin condition characterised by persistent scaly plaques on the scalp, face, and ears which subsequently can progress to scarring, atrophy, dyspigmentation, and permanent hair loss in affected hair-bearing areas. It is the most common form of cutaneous lupus. WebAging and the ear Physiologic changes related to advancing age involve both the peripheral and central auditory pathways. De generative changes can be seen in the pinna, and atrophy can be seen within the ear canal in the skin, appendages, and the eardrum.
